Whether expected or sudden, the death of someone close to us can trigger a complex mix of emotions:
- Overwhelming sadness and emptiness
- Anger at the situation or even at the deceased
- Guilt about things left unsaid or undone
- Regret about missed opportunities to say goodbye
- Resentment about being left behind
- Loneliness and isolation
Bereavement Counselling includes Grief, Loss and Pet Bereavement. It frequently uncovers other issues such as Depression, Low Self-Esteem, and Anxiety. I am fully qualified in these and will help you with them as part of our programme.

Many of my clients tell me how important it is to talk to someone who is not a family member. Especially if the deceased is a husband, wife or partner. There are aspects of your relationship you do not want to discuss with family.
